What Does 嵌 (qiān) Mean?
At its core, 嵌 (qiān) translates to “embed,” “inset,” or “to set into.” It captures the essence of something being firmly placed or supported within another object. The character is often used in both literal and metaphorical contexts, making it versatile in various expressions.
Literal Meaning
In literal terms, 嵌 can describe physical objects that are embedded into larger structures. For example, you might use it to refer to a jewel that is set into a ring or stones that are fixed into walls.
Metaphorical Meaning
Metaphorically, 嵌 can refer to concepts or ideas being integrated or included within a broader context. It’s often used in literature, art, and discussions about culture where the embedding of themes or elements is significant.
The Grammatical Structure of 嵌
In Mandarin, 嵌 is primarily used as a verb. However, it can also function as a component in compound words or phrases. Here, we will dissect its grammatical structure and how it fits into sentences.
As a Verb
When 嵌 is used as a verb, it often follows specific sentence structures that include a subject, an object, and sometimes an auxiliary verb to convey tense. The basic sentence structure typically looks like this:
- Subject + 嵌 + Object
- Example: 我嵌了一颗宝石在戒指上。 (Wǒ qiānle yī kē bǎoshí zài jièzhǐ shàng.) – “I embedded a gem in the ring.”
In Compound Phrases
嵌 can also form part of compound phrases, resulting in new meanings. Here are a few examples:
- 嵌入 (qiān rù) – “to be embedded” (e.g., software functionality).
- 嵌套 (qiān tào) – “nesting” (often used in programming contexts).
Example Sentences Using 嵌
To further illustrate the usage of 嵌, here are several example sentences in Mandarin, along with their English translations:
Example 1
这幅画嵌在墙上。
(Zhè fú huà qiān zài qiáng shàng.)
“This painting is embedded in the wall.”
Example 2
作者巧妙地将传统元素嵌入现代设计中。
(Zuòzhě qiǎomiào de jiāng chuántǒng yuánsù qiān rù xiàndài shèjì zhōng.)
“The author skillfully embedded traditional elements into modern design.”
Example 3
她喜欢在她的文章中嵌入个人故事。
(Tā xǐhuān zài tā de wénzhāng zhōng qiān rù gèrén gùshì.)
“She likes to embed personal stories in her articles.”
